About Gretchen Warland

Gretchen Warland is a scholar working on Rehabilitation, Dermatology and Cell Biology, having authored 12 papers that have together received 364 indexed citations. Recurring topics across this work include Colorectal and Anal Carcinomas (6 papers), Wound Healing and Treatments (5 papers) and Colorectal Cancer Surgical Treatments (4 papers). The work is most often cited by research in Rehabilitation (83 citations), Oncology (189 citations) and Surgery (202 citations). Gretchen Warland has collaborated with scholars based in United States, Austria and Sweden. Frequent co-authors include Carolyn C. Compton, Christopher G. Willett, Paul C. Shellito, John J. Coen, Michael P. Hagan, Dennis P. Orgill, Charles E. Butler, Ioannis V. Yannas, Marcia Simon and J.T. Efird. Their work appears in journals such as Journal of Clinical Oncology, Gastroenterology and International Journal of Radiation Oncology*Biology*Physics.
